Schwefelgelbe Koralle vs Dreifarbige Koralle

Ramaria flava compared with Ramaria formosa

Key Differences

  • Schwefelgelbe Koralle is Not Evaluated while Dreifarbige Koralle is Near Threatened.

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Schwefelgelbe Koralle Dreifarbige Koralle
Kingdom same Fungi (Pilze) Fungi (Pilze)
Phylum same Basidiomycota (Ständerpilze) Basidiomycota (Ständerpilze)
Class same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ms)
Order same Gomphales (Gomphales) Gomphales (Gomphales)
Family same Gomphaceae Gomphaceae
Genus same Ramaria Ramaria
Species Ramaria flava Ramaria formosa

Evolutionary Relationship

Schwefelgelbe Koralle and Dreifarbige Koralle share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Ramaria.
